Beef and Dhal Curry

Beef and Dhal Curry is a traditional Indian recipe for a classic curry of beef strips and lentils in a spiced chilli, garlic and onion base with tomato puree. The full recipe is presented here and I hope you enjoy this classic Indian version of: Beef and Dhal Curry.

Ingredients:

500g lean beef, cut into 4cm pieces
2 dry red chillies
2 garlic cloves, finely chopped
2 large onions, finely chopped
vinegar
1 dessert spoon tomato purée
1 dessert spoon ./search.php?cat=1&ingredient=curry+powder&t=1">curry powder
115g lentils
2 cloves
60g ghee
3cm length of cinnamon stick
salt, to taste

Method:

Melt the ghee in a pan and when hot add the whole spices and onion. Stir-fry for 4 minutes then add the garlic and fry for 3 minutes more before adding the ./search.php?cat=1&ingredient=curry+powder&t=1">curry powder. Continue cooking for 5 minutes more then add the tomato purée and meat. Cover the pan and cook for 4 minutes further.

In the meantime, place the lentils in a pan, cover with water, bring to a boil and cook for about 20 minutes, or until just tender. Drain the lentils (reserve the cooking water). Add 200ml of the lentil cooking liquid to the pan.

Bring to a simmer, cover the pan and cook gently for about 60 minutes, or until the meat is thoroughly cooked through and tender. Now stir in the lentils and add about a tbsp of vinegar (or to taste). Season to taste with salt, cover the pan and cook for about 10 minutes more, or until the lentils have completely broken down to form a thick sauce.

Serve hot.
